import unittest
import os
from gem5.resources.workload import Workload, CustomWorkload
from gem5.resources.resource import (
BinaryResource,
DiskImageResource,
obtain_resource,
)
from typing import Dict
class CustomWorkloadTestSuite(unittest.TestCase):
"""
Tests the `gem5.resources.workload.CustomWorkload` class.
"""
@classmethod
def setUpClass(cls) -> None:
os.environ["GEM5_RESOURCE_JSON"] = os.path.join(
os.path.realpath(os.path.dirname(__file__)),
"refs",
"workload-checks-custom-workload.json",
)
cls.custom_workload = CustomWorkload(
function="set_se_binary_workload",
parameters={
"binary": obtain_resource("x86-hello64-static"),
"arguments": ["hello", 6],
},
)
@classmethod
def tearDownClass(cls):
# Unset the environment variable so this test does not interfere with
# others.
os.environ["GEM5_RESOURCE_JSON"]
def test_get_function_str(self) -> None:
# Tests `CustomResource.get_function_str`
self.assertEqual(
"set_se_binary_workload", self.custom_workload.get_function_str()
)
def test_get_parameters(self) -> None:
# Tests `CustomResource.get_parameter`
parameters = self.custom_workload.get_parameters()
self.assertTrue(isinstance(parameters, Dict))
self.assertEquals(2, len(parameters))
self.assertTrue("binary" in parameters)
self.assertTrue(isinstance(parameters["binary"], BinaryResource))
self.assertTrue("arguments" in parameters)
self.assertTrue(isinstance(parameters["arguments"], list))
self.assertEquals(2, len(parameters["arguments"]))
self.assertEquals("hello", parameters["arguments"][0])
self.assertEquals(6, parameters["arguments"][1])
def test_add_parameters(self) -> None:
# Tests `CustomResource.set_parameter` for the case where we add a new
# parameter value.
self.custom_workload.set_parameter("test_param", 10)
self.assertTrue("test_param" in self.custom_workload.get_parameters())
self.assertEquals(
10, self.custom_workload.get_parameters()["test_param"]
)
# Cleanup
del self.custom_workload.get_parameters()["test_param"]
def test_override_parameter(self) -> None:
# Tests `CustomResource.set_parameter` for the case where we override
# a parameter's value.
old_value = self.custom_workload.get_parameters()["binary"]
self.custom_workload.set_parameter("binary", "test")
self.assertTrue("binary" in self.custom_workload.get_parameters())
self.assertEquals(
"test", self.custom_workload.get_parameters()["binary"]
)
# We set the overridden parameter back to it's old value.
self.custom_workload.set_parameter("binary", old_value)
class WorkloadTestSuite(unittest.TestCase):
"""
Tests the `gem5.resources.workload.Workload` class.
"""
@classmethod
def setUpClass(cls):
os.environ["GEM5_RESOURCE_JSON"] = os.path.join(
os.path.realpath(os.path.dirname(__file__)),
"refs",
"workload-checks.json",
)
cls.workload = Workload("simple-boot")
@classmethod
def tearDownClass(cls):
# Unset the environment variable so this test does not interfere with
# others.
os.environ["GEM5_RESOURCE_JSON"]
def test_get_function_str(self) -> None:
# Tests `Resource.get_function_str`
self.assertEquals(
"set_kernel_disk_workload", self.workload.get_function_str()
)
def test_get_parameters(self) -> None:
# Tests `Resource.get_parameters`
parameters = self.workload.get_parameters()
self.assertTrue(isinstance(parameters, Dict))
self.assertEqual(3, len(parameters))
self.assertTrue("kernel" in parameters)
self.assertTrue(isinstance(parameters["kernel"], BinaryResource))
self.assertTrue("disk_image" in parameters)
self.assertTrue(
isinstance(parameters["disk_image"], DiskImageResource)
)
self.assertTrue("readfile_contents" in parameters)
self.assertTrue(
"echo 'Boot successful'; m5 exit", parameters["readfile_contents"]
)
def test_add_parameters(self) -> None:
# Tests `Resource.set_parameter` for the case where we add a new
# parameter value.
self.workload.set_parameter("test_param", 10)
self.assertTrue("test_param" in self.workload.get_parameters())
self.assertEquals(10, self.workload.get_parameters()["test_param"])
# Cleanup
del self.workload.get_parameters()["test_param"]
def test_override_parameter(self) -> None:
# Tests `Resource.set_parameter` for the case where we override
# a parameter's value.
old_value = self.workload.get_parameters()["readfile_contents"]
self.workload.set_parameter("readfile_contents", "test")
self.assertTrue("readfile_contents" in self.workload.get_parameters())
self.assertEquals(
"test", self.workload.get_parameters()["readfile_contents"]
)
# We set the overridden parameter back to it's old value.
self.workload.set_parameter("readfile_contents", old_value)
